The Verdant Start: Cassardis and Its Surroundings
Your journey begins in the humble fishing village of Cassardis. This initial area serves as your tutorial, introducing you to the basic mechanics of combat, exploration, and questing. Take your time to familiarize yourself with the controls, learn how to parry, dodge, and utilize your vocation's skills effectively. The surrounding wilderness, while seemingly benign, hides early dangers. Keep an eye out for Goblins and Hobgoblins, formidable in groups, and the occasional Cyclops that might wander too close to the village. Gathering resources is crucial in these early stages. Herbs for healing, ore for potential weapon upgrades, and crafting materials will be vital for your survival. Speak to every NPC you encounter; they often provide valuable information, side quests, or sell essential items. The Pawn Guild in Cassardis is also a key location, allowing you to recruit new Pawns or customize your own. Don't neglect the initial quests given by the villagers; they not only offer experience and gold but also introduce you to the lore of the world and the looming threat of the Dragon. As you venture further, you'll encounter more challenging enemies and discover hidden paths. Pay attention to the time of day; certain creatures only appear at night, and the darkness brings its own set of perils, often more dangerous than their daytime counterparts. Mastering the basics in Cassardis will set a strong precedent for the trials that lie ahead.
The First Great Escape: Into the Wider World
Once you've completed the initial quests in Cassardis and felt confident in your combat abilities, it’s time to venture out into the wider world. Your first major destination will likely be the Capital City of Gran Soren. The journey there is fraught with peril, but also brimming with opportunities for growth and discovery. Along the main path, you'll encounter Wolves, often in packs, and more challenging variants of Goblins. Be prepared to utilize your Pawn's skills effectively, especially if they specialize in healing or ranged attacks. Don't shy away from exploring the side paths; you might find hidden chests, rare crafting materials, or even discover secret areas that offer unique challenges or rewards. The Gorgon Cave is an early optional dungeon that can yield valuable loot, but be wary of its traps and the venomous gaze of the Gorgon itself. As you approach Gran Soren, the landscape becomes more rugged, and you might encounter larger beasts like Griffins or even the occasional Hydra. Learning enemy attack patterns and exploiting their weaknesses is paramount. For instance, some enemies are particularly vulnerable to fire, while others are best dealt with using blunt weapons. Resource management is also key; ensure your inventory is stocked with healing items and that your Pawns are equipped with the best gear you can afford or find. This transition from the safety of Cassardis to the harsh realities of the open world is a critical learning curve. Embrace the challenge, learn from your mistakes, and you'll soon find yourself ready to face the trials within Gran Soren.
